In the printed electronics market, the user can choose from photonic devices and printed electronics mounted on a variety of different substrates. The printing technologies used are lithography, rotogravure, digital, screen, and flexography. Using ink, these techniques print on materials such as cloth, paper, and plastic.

The method of printing is often used on wearable devices, by the sports industry, and for flexible screens, among other applications. Additionally, the healthcare sector has benefited from recent developments in printed electronics, which range from integrated nanoscale sensors, electronics, and microfluidics to advanced synthetics. The healthcare industry has seen an unprecedented increase in the adoption of stretchable electronics, also known as soft electronics, due to their ability to bend, stretch, and twist easily to mold into the shape of the required object, such as implantable devices, and their ability to transfer data from and to computers and smartphones. There are numerous forms of it, including thin, tattoo-like electronics that can be directly attached to the skin (e.g., sensors of physiological health) and physically flexible electronics that can be implanted into the body (e.g., post-surgery monitoring devices). Printed electronics have grown in popularity in the healthcare sector due to the increasing demand for real-time monitoring of patients with serious medical conditions, as well as for health-condition monitoring and management in the military and sports sectors. Innovative technology and high adoption from the consumer base has also led to the creation of even more stretchable, flexible, and conformal biosensors that can be used for medical monitoring, diagnostics, and drug delivery.
